DockerInit.sh 713 B

12345678910111213141516171819202122
  1. #!/bin/sh
  2. if [ $1 == "amd64" ]; then
  3. ARCH="64";
  4. FNAME="amd64";
  5. elif [ $1 == "arm64" ]; then
  6. ARCH="arm64-v8a"
  7. FNAME="arm64";
  8. else
  9. ARCH="64";
  10. FNAME="amd64";
  11. fi
  12. mkdir -p build/bin
  13. cd build/bin
  14. wget "https://github.com/mhsanaei/xray-core/releases/latest/download/Xray-linux-${ARCH}.zip"
  15. unzip "Xray-linux-${ARCH}.zip"
  16. rm -f "Xray-linux-${ARCH}.zip" geoip.dat geosite.dat iran.dat
  17. mv xray "xray-linux-${FNAME}"
  18. wget "https://github.com/Loyalsoldier/v2ray-rules-dat/releases/latest/download/geoip.dat"
  19. wget "https://github.com/Loyalsoldier/v2ray-rules-dat/releases/latest/download/geosite.dat"
  20. wget "https://github.com/bootmortis/iran-hosted-domains/releases/latest/download/iran.dat"
  21. cd ../../